Understanding the Fundamentals of Informed Betting
Before diving into specific strategies or platforms, it’s crucial to establish a foundation of knowledge regarding the core principles of betting. This encompasses not only understanding the different types of bets available – such as moneyline, spread, over/under, and parlays – but also grasping the concepts of odds, probability, and value. Odds, often expressed in decimal, fractional, or American formats, represent the likelihood of an event occurring and dictate the potential payout. Probability, conversely, quantifies the chance of an event happening, usually expressed as a percentage. Value, arguably the most critical concept, refers to identifying bets where the potential payout exceeds the implied probability of success. A bet offers value when you believe the true probability of an outcome is higher than the probability suggested by the odds offered by the bookmaker.
Furthermore, understanding bankroll management is indispensable for long-term success. A bankroll is the total amount of money dedicated to betting, and proper management involves setting limits on bet sizes to avoid significant losses. A common rule of thumb is to bet no more than 1-5% of your bankroll on a single event. Diversification is also key; spreading your bets across multiple events and bet types can mitigate risk. It's also vital to keep detailed records of your bets, including the amount wagered, the odds, and the outcome. This allows you to analyze your performance, identify strengths and weaknesses, and refine your strategies over time. Without disciplined bankroll management, even the most astute betting insights can be undermined by reckless wagering.
The Role of Data and Analytics
In the modern era of betting, data and analytics have become increasingly essential. Access to historical performance data, player statistics, team form, and even weather conditions can provide valuable insights that inform betting decisions. Numerous websites and services specialize in providing this type of information, offering detailed analyses and predictive models. However, it's important to approach these resources with a critical eye. No model is perfect, and relying solely on automated predictions without applying your own judgment can be a mistake. Consider the source of the data, the methodology used, and any potential biases that may be present. The ability to interpret data effectively and integrate it with your own understanding of the sport or game is what separates successful bettors from the rest.
| Bet Type | Description | Risk Level | Potential Payout |
|---|---|---|---|
| Moneyline | Betting on the outright winner of a game. | Low to Medium | Typically lower, but more predictable. |
| Spread Betting | Betting on a team to win by a certain margin. | Medium | Moderate, requires accurate prediction of the margin. |
| Over/Under | Betting on whether the total score will be over or under a specified number. | Low to Medium | Moderate, requires predicting the total score accurately. |
| Parlay | Combining multiple bets into one. | High | Potentially very high, but requires all bets to win. |
Effective data analysis isn't just about finding statistics; it's about understanding the narratives they tell. Why is a particular player performing well? Has a team changed its strategy? Are there any injuries or suspensions that could impact the outcome? These are the types of questions that should guide your research. And don't overlook the importance of qualitative factors, such as team morale, coaching decisions, and even psychological aspects of the game.

Strategies for Maximizing Potential Wins
While there’s no guaranteed formula for success in betting, certain strategies can significantly improve your chances of winning. One popular approach is value betting, as discussed previously – identifying bets where the odds offered by the bookmaker don't accurately reflect the true probability of an outcome. Another strategy is arbitrage betting, which involves exploiting differences in odds offered by different bookmakers to guarantee a profit, regardless of the outcome. However, arbitrage opportunities are often short-lived and require quick action. More sophisticated strategies include statistical modeling, using regression analysis and other techniques to predict outcomes based on historical data. However, these approaches require a strong understanding of statistics and a significant amount of data.
Beyond specific betting strategies, it’s important to develop a broader understanding of the sport or game you’re betting on. This involves following the latest news, analyzing team dynamics, and understanding the nuances of the competition. Long-term success in betting requires a disciplined approach, a willingness to learn from your mistakes, and a constant commitment to refining your strategies. Avoiding emotional betting – making bets based on gut feeling rather than rational analysis – is also crucial. Emotional betting often leads to impulsive decisions and poor outcomes. Treating betting as a long-term investment, rather than a quick way to make money, is the key to sustainable success.

The Importance of Responsible Gambling Practices
While the potential for financial gain can be alluring, it's crucial to approach betting with a responsible mindset. Gambling should be viewed as a form of entertainment, not a source of income. Setting limits on your spending and time spent betting is essential. Never bet more than you can afford to lose, and avoid borrowing money to fund your betting activities. Be aware of the signs of problem gambling, such as spending increasing amounts of money, chasing losses, or neglecting other important aspects of your life. If you suspect you may have a gambling problem, seek help from a support organization or mental health professional. Many resources are available to provide guidance and support.
